A.J. Brown is developing strong chemistry with Drake Maye at Patriots training camp after arriving via trade on June 1. The duo struggled during the first four non-padded practices but have connected significantly since pads came on Thursday. In red-zone work Thursday, Maye connected on four of five passes to Brown, resulting in at least two would-be touchdowns on slants. On Friday, Brown beat Christian Gonzalez on a double move to haul in a 40+ yard deep shot down the right sideline on Maye's first pass of full-team work, then caught back-to-back completions in low red-zone 11-on-11 work. Maye emphasized Brown's elite status: "He's a force in this league, he's been a force in this league… I am blessed to play with a player like him."PositiveUsageJul 31, 2026

A.J. Brown, acquired via trade (first- and fifth-round picks to Philadelphia), has been fairly quiet through four practices in the Patriots' famously complex system under offensive coordinator Josh McDaniels. The source notes that his connection with starting quarterback Drake Maye is developmental and that four practices are not enough time to build chemistry; the goal is to be functional by the regular season. The Patriots are trying to get Brown and fellow X-receiver Kayshon Boutte on the field together in select packages.PositiveProjectionJul 30, 2026
